TourShare is a tournament travel coordination platform built for tennis players who need a better way to connect before tournament week. Players can use TourShare to find others attending the same events, coordinate housing, share rides, arrange practice sessions, message players, and reduce travel stress.
Many players travel to tournaments without knowing who else is arriving, where people are staying, who needs a warmup, or who might be available to split hotel or transportation costs. TourShare organizes those needs around tournament hubs so players can plan earlier and communicate in one place.

Why TourShare exists
Tournament travel can be expensive and stressful, especially for players competing on a budget. Hotel costs, airport rides, practice access, stringing, food, and transportation all add up. TourShare was created to make it easier for players to find useful connections before they arrive.
TourShare is not a tournament organizer, travel agency, hotel provider, ride service, or official representative of any tennis organization. It is an independent coordination tool that helps players communicate and make their own informed decisions.
